Transaction 95d44584b4bee76ec3f99e31177aee94e25b8c4c5d93c8725cda22dc98f34b89

1 Input
2 Outputs
  • 95d44584b4bee76ec3f99e31177aee94e25b8c4c5d93c8725cda22dc98f34b89:0
  • value  30900000
    address  394ybD6ScJrr4frre5dGmE3EaRPSx1XEM5
  • 95d44584b4bee76ec3f99e31177aee94e25b8c4c5d93c8725cda22dc98f34b89:1
  • value  337841323
    address  1PBNyiBjtVriaqkJ3LVdiLV9jCg5edgzxf